In Jira Service Management Request forms, we are looking for a feature to auto-fill "Approvers" field with immediate Manager name as in Azure AD. Doing this will enter correct Manager name, else it may allow Customers to add incorrect Manager name.
How can we achieve this? We are using Atlassian Access connected with Azure AD for User provisioning.
Environment: Jira Cloud (JSM Cloud)
You can automate routing of approvals to managers from Azure AD using the Multiplier plugin on Jira cloud:
This uses post functions to pull in the manager from AD and insert that into the Approvers field in Jira. See this for more details: https://docs.multiplierhq.com/article/18-how-to-route-jira-service-management-approvals-to-azure-ad-manager
